Read More2026 Ohio School Counselor of the Year Nominations
The Ohio School Counselor Association (OSCA) is now accepting nominations from professionals for the 2026 Ohio School Counselor of the Year (OSCOY). This year, OSCA will be recognizing up to five (5) finalists for this top award with one person being named OSCOY. The OSCOY will then go on to represent Ohio for the National School Counselor of the Year recognition.Â

Please join us for the Compact’s 13th Annual Statewide Conference, which will be held in person on February 26-27, 2026, at The Conference Center at OCLC in Dublin, Ohio. We are very pleased to, once again, collaborate with OCTEO in planning and offering this two-day event. The preliminary schedule can be downloaded from the Compact website linked here.
